6.1 Alarm Displays
6.1.1 List of Alarms
6-4
A.7A2
Internal Temperature Error
2 (Power Board Tempera-
ture Error)
The surrounding temperature of the power PCB
is abnormal.
Gr.2 Yes
A.7A3
Internal Temperature
Sensor Error
An error occurred in the temperature sensor cir-
cuit.
Gr.2 No
A.7Ab SERVOPACK Built-in Fan
Stopped
The fan inside the SERVOPACK stopped. Gr.1 Yes
A.810 Encoder Backup Alarm
The power supplies to the encoder all failed and
the position data was lost.
Gr.1 No
A.820 Encoder Checksum Alarm
There is an error in the checksum results for
encoder memory.
Gr.1 No
A.830 Encoder Battery Alarm
The battery voltage was lower than the specified
level after the control power supply was turned
ON.
Gr.1 Yes
A.840 Encoder Data Alarm There is an internal data error in the encoder. Gr.1 No
A.850 Encoder Overspeed
The encoder was operating at high speed when
the power was turned ON.
Gr.1 No
A.860 Encoder Overheated The internal temperature of encoder is too high. Gr.1 No
A.861 Motor Overheated The internal temperature of motor is too high. Gr.1 No
A.862 Overheat Alarm
The input voltage (temperature) for the overheat
protection input (TH) signal exceeded the setting
of Pn61B (Overheat Alarm Level).
Gr.1 Yes
A.890 Encoder Scale Error A failure occurred in the linear encoder. Gr.1 No
A.891 Encoder Module Error An error occurred in the linear encoder. Gr.1 No
A.b33 Current Detection Error 3 An error occurred in the current detection circuit. Gr.1 No
